Defining Family Law:

Family law encompasses a broad spectrum of legal matters that pertain to familial relationships and domestic issues. It is a specialized area of law designed to address the unique challenges and complexities that arise within families. Key components of family law include:

  1. Divorce and Legal Separation: Family law governs the process of divorce, including the division of marital property, spousal support, and the establishment of child custody and visitation arrangements. Legal separation, an alternative to divorce, allows couples to live apart while remaining legally married.
  2. Child Custody and Visitation: Determining the custody and visitation arrangements for children is a central aspect of family law. Courts strive to establish arrangements that prioritize the best interests of the child, considering factors such as parental fitness, stability, and the child’s well-being.
  3. Child and Spousal Support: Family law addresses the financial responsibilities of parents through child support and spousal support (alimony). Calculations take into account factors like income, expenses, and the needs of the supported party or child.
  4. Adoption: The legal process of adoption falls under family law, ensuring that adoptive parents follow the necessary procedures to establish legal relationships with adopted children. Family law attorneys facilitate this process, which may involve terminating parental rights and obtaining consent.

Marriage and Divorce

  1. Marriage Laws: Family law governs the legal aspects of marriage, from the creation of prenuptial agreements to the recognition of marital rights and responsibilities. Attorneys specializing in family law guide couples through the legal requirements and implications of marriage.
  2. Divorce Proceedings: When marriages break down, family law attorneys are instrumental in facilitating divorce proceedings. This involves addressing issues such as division of assets, spousal support, and, in some cases, resolving disputes regarding child custody and visitation.

Child Custody and Support

  1. Child Custody Determination: Family law plays a crucial role in determining child custody arrangements in cases of divorce or separation. The court considers factors such as the child’s best interests, parental capacity, and the existing relationship between the child and each parent.
  2. Child Support Obligations: Family law also governs child support obligations, ensuring that noncustodial parents contribute financially to the upbringing of their children. Child support calculations take into account factors such as parental income, the number of children, and specific child-related expenses.

Adoption and Guardianship

  1. Adoption Processes: Family law facilitates the legal adoption process, ensuring that prospective adoptive parents meet the necessary requirements and guiding them through the legal steps to finalize the adoption. This includes termination of parental rights, home studies, and court appearances.
  2. Guardianship Matters: In cases where biological parents are unable to care for their children, family law addresses guardianship matters. The court may appoint a legal guardian to assume responsibility for the child’s well-being, making decisions related to education, healthcare, and general welfare.

Domestic Violence and Restraining Orders

  1. Protection Against Domestic Violence: Family law provides mechanisms to protect individuals from domestic violence. Attorneys can assist victims in obtaining restraining orders, which prohibit the abuser from making contact and may include provisions for child custody and support.

Spousal Support and Alimony

  1. Determining Spousal Support: Family law governs the determination of spousal support or alimony in cases of divorce. The court considers factors such as the length of the marriage, each spouse’s financial situation, and the standard of living during the marriage when deciding on support arrangements.

Mediation and Alternative Dispute Resolution

  1. Promoting Amicable Resolutions: Family law encourages alternative dispute resolution methods such as mediation to resolve family disputes amicably. Mediation involves a neutral third party facilitating communication between parties, fostering compromise, and reaching mutually acceptable agreements.

International Family Law Matters

  1. Cross-Border Issues: In an increasingly interconnected world, family law also deals with international matters, such as child abduction cases and jurisdictional conflicts. Legal professionals specializing in international family law navigate the complexities of legal systems across borders.

Check the American Bar Association. You will likely need a good attorney when it comes time to file your case. The American Bar Association (ABA) is a great starting place. While they don’t offer reviews or ratings, you can find out if a potential lawyer is in good standing or if he or she has had any disciplinary action taken.

When choosing a personal injury lawyer, pay special attention to the size of their firm. Generally, larger firms mean that more than one lawyer may work on your case. These are usually Associate Attorneys who are trying to gain some legal experience, while having a senior attorney oversee and make the final decisions. Smaller firms can usually provide better management by having fewer people working on a case. Feel free to ask if other attorneys will be working on your case in any firm you’re interested in.

Consider using the local bar association to help you find a quality personal injury lawyer. Some do a wonderful job of screening out attorneys that do not have the experience that you are looking for or the qualifications that you need. Talk with the association about your needs and ask about what their screening process is like.
